When it comes to vehicle reliability, some models stand out for their durability and low maintenance needs. Mechanics often praise certain vehicles for requiring minimal major repairs over their lifespan. Here are seven vehicles that mechanics say rarely need significant attention, making them ideal choices for those seeking a dependable mode of transportation.
Honda Civic

The Honda Civic is a perennial favorite among mechanics for its reliability. Known for its sturdy build and efficient engineering, this compact car has consistently ranked high in customer satisfaction surveys. Models from the early 2000s, particularly the 2006-2011 versions, are noted for their longevity.
Owners often report few issues beyond routine maintenance, which includes oil changes and brake replacements. The Civic’s well-designed engine and transmission systems contribute to its reputation for reliability, making it a smart choice for budget-conscious drivers.
Toyota Corolla

The Toyota Corolla is another model that garners praise from automotive professionals. With a history of dependable performance, this compact sedan has been a staple in the market since its introduction. The 2014-2019 models are particularly known for their low repair frequency.
Mechanics appreciate the Corolla’s straightforward design, which translates to fewer complications over time. Regular maintenance is typically all that is needed to keep this vehicle running smoothly, ensuring peace of mind for its owners.
Subaru Outback

For those seeking versatility and reliability, the Subaru Outback is a top contender. This crossover is well-regarded for its all-wheel-drive capabilities and rugged construction. Models from 2015 onward have received accolades for their durability and low incidence of major repairs.
Subaru’s commitment to safety and quality engineering means that routine maintenance can often be performed without significant investment. Owners of the Outback frequently report high levels of satisfaction with the vehicle’s reliability, especially in challenging weather conditions.
Mazda MX-5 Miata

The Mazda MX-5 Miata is not just a sports car but also a model known for its longevity. With its lightweight design and efficient engine, the Miata has earned a reputation for requiring minimal maintenance. The 2016 model and newer have been particularly noted for their reliability.
Many enthusiasts appreciate that the Miata can be enjoyed for years without encountering major repair issues, making it a practical choice for those who value performance and dependability.
Ford F-150

As one of the best-selling trucks in America, the Ford F-150 is lauded for its durability and reliability. The 2015 and 2016 models are particularly renowned for their robust build and low repair rates. Mechanics often point to the F-150 as a vehicle that can withstand heavy use without significant problems.
Its strong engine options and solid construction make it a favorite among truck owners who need a vehicle for both work and personal use. Regular maintenance helps to ensure that the F-150 remains dependable for years.
Toyota Highlander

The Toyota Highlander is a midsize SUV that combines comfort and reliability. Models from 2017 and later have been noted for their low incidence of major repairs, making them a popular choice for families. The Highlander’s spacious interior and safety features further enhance its appeal.
Mechanics often report that regular maintenance keeps the Highlander running smoothly, allowing families to enjoy their travels without the stress of unexpected repairs. Its reputation for reliability is well-deserved, making it a solid investment.
Honda CR-V

The Honda CR-V has become synonymous with reliability and practicality. Known for its spacious interior and fuel efficiency, the CR-V has models, particularly from 2015 onward, that are praised for their low repair needs.
